In this criminal appeal, defendant raises four assignments of error. Defendant argues that the trial court erred (1) in denying his motion to suppress the confession he made, which he asserts was obtained in violation of his Miranda rights; (2) in denying his motion to suppress evidence obtained from an inventory search of his wallet...
